Chowan University Inducts Nineteen Members into Alpha Chi National Honor Society
On the 27th of October 2022, Chowan University inducted nineteen students into the North Carolina Phi Chapter of Alpha Chi. Vaughan Auditorium facilitated the well-attended twenty-sixth annual induction ceremony, which saw a student-led presentation accompanied by the 2021-2022 Alpha Chi Teacher of the Year, Jason Fowler.
Alpha Chi is a coeducational academic honor society. Since 1992, its purpose has been to promote academic excellence and exemplary character among colleges and university students and to honor those who achieve such distinction. The name of the organization is derived from the Greek words meaning truth and character. As a general honor society, Alpha Chi admits to membership students from all academic disciplines. Along with Phi Beta Kappa and Phi Kappa Phi, Alpha Chi is one of the most prestigious and widely recognized honor societies in the nation.
To be tapped for membership in the North Carolina Phi Chapter of Alpha Chi at Chowan University, a student must have successfully completed 24 hours of class credit at Chowan, earned a grade point average of 3.5 or higher, and ranked within the top 10 percent of the junior and senior class combined.
